How to Clean Phone Screen Without Alcohol

Using alcohol directly can ruin the screen’s coating. Try these steps instead:

  • Turn off your phone and unplug it
  • Use a soft microfiber cloth for phone cleaning
  • Dampen it slightly with clean water (not dripping)
  • Gently wipe in circles
  • Let it air dry

How to Clean Phone Screen With Household Items

You don’t need expensive cleaners. Here’s how to clean phone screen with household items:

  • Mix warm water and a drop of dish soap
  • Dip a microfiber cloth in the mix and wring it out
  • Wipe the screen gently
  • Dry with a fresh microfiber cloth

Homemade Phone Screen Cleaner (DIY Method)

You can make a DIY phone cleaner solution at home:

DIY Clean Solution

DIY Cleaner Recipe:

  • 50% distilled water
  • 50% white vinegar
  • Mix in a spray bottle (spray on cloth, NOT phone)

How to Disinfect Phone Screen Without Damage

If you want to disinfect phone screen at home, follow this:

  • Use disinfectant wipes marked “safe for electronics”
  • OR make a mix of 70% isopropyl alcohol + 30% water
  • Spray on cloth only
  • Gently wipe the phone surface

🛑 Never spray directly on your phone!

Precautions Before Cleaning Your Phone

Before you begin cleaning:

Precautions Before Clean Screen
  • Always turn off your phone
  • Avoid getting water in charging ports
  • Don’t use paper towels (can scratch screen)
  • Don’t use strong chemicals like bleach
  • Avoid pressing too hard on the screen

Mistakes to Avoid While Cleaning Your Phone Screen

Here’s what not to do:

  • Don’t use window or kitchen cleaners
  • Don’t soak your phone
  • Don’t use tissue paper
  • Don’t clean while phone is charging
  • Don’t use rough cloth or sponge
  • Don’t spray anything directly on the phone
  • Don’t forget to clean the phone case too

Can I use alcohol wipes to clean my phone?

Yes, but you must choose the right kind of alcohol and use it carefully:

  • Use 70% isopropyl alcohol wipes—they’re safe for screens.
  • Avoid strong disinfectants or bleach.
  • Gently wipe the screen, not soaking it.
  • Don’t let liquid enter charging ports or speaker holes.
What is the best thing to clean a screen with?

For a clean and scratch-free screen, these tools work best:

  • Microfiber cloths – soft, lint-free, and non-abrasive.
  • Distilled water – safer than tap water, leaves no residue.
  • Isopropyl alcohol (70%) – for disinfecting without damage.
  • Screen-safe sprays – specifically made for electronics.
  • Avoid window cleaners or abrasive cloths.
